04-27-17   Gaea Star Crystal Radio Hour #259 was taped at Singing Brook Studio on Worthington, Massachusetts on a sunny day filled with the promise of spring, and features the Gaea Star Band with Mariam Massaro on vocals, ukulele, native flute and acoustic guitar, Craig Harris on congas and drums and Bob Sherwood on piano.  We begin with a lovely, mystical, mist-soaked piece called “Sweet Papayas” that joins Mariam’s exposition of her recent trip the Big Island in Hawaii with music that seeks to replicate the sweet climes of the Hawaiian Islands.  A rich, varied and evocative piece, “Sweet Papayas” opens up for a coda featuring Mariam’s pretty, piping G flute and more gracious, lovely poetry in praise of Maui.  “We Are Sharing Beauty Ways” begins somberly with minor chords from Mariam’s acoustic guitar and sensitive accompaniment from Craig on congas.  This gorgeous, unhurried piece visits realms of deep peace and mysticism, a visionary vocal from Mariam duetting with her calm, sweeping native flute over stately congas and deeply emotional piano inventions.  Following the break we visit three powerful pieces from Mariam that feature on her albums.  “Reborn” from the “Gaea Star Crystal:  Awakening the Tribes Of Light” soundtrack, is taken as a driving, hybrid waltz led by a fine vocal and assertive acoustic guitar from Mariam.  “I’m The Full Moon” from the “Gaea Star Goddesses” album is a song of praise and reverence to the moon and the night-hunting goddess Artemis and is presented in a greatly rocked-up arrangement.  The powerful, deeply elemental and earthen “I Am The Mother Earth” closes the show today with deep drum pulses from Craig and a profound vocal performance from Mariam, exposing the deep poetry of this song originally featured on the “Vision Quest” album.
